Hyundai invests in a grain-based leather alternative

Hyundai Cradle, the global open innovation hub of Hyundai Motor Group, has entered into a partnership with Uncaged Innovations, a biomaterials company, to create a sustainable, animal-free leather for automotive interiors, made using grain byproducts.

The partners are working to co-develop high-performance, bio-based leather alternatives that replace traditional leather materials. Uncaged’s Elevate grain-based protein leather is engineered to reduce resource consumption on multiple fronts, with the company claiming its production process uses 95% less greenhouse gas emissions, 89% less water, and 71% less energy compared to animal-based leather, while still offering good qualities of texture, durability and luxurious quality.

“Uncaged’s grain-based protein leather alternative stood out to us for its unique molecular design and manufacturing process, which allows us to drastically lower environmental impact while meeting the demanding quality and performance standards of automotive interiors,” said Brendon Kim, senior vice president and head of Hyundai’s Cradle office in Silicon Valley, USA.

“Uncaged’s approach, which minimises chemical inputs and leverages natural resources like coffee bean shells for dyes, aligns perfectly with Hyundai Motor Group’s sustainability material strategy of prioritising high bio content and minimal chemical use.”

Uncaged Innovations combines its proprietary technology platform, BioFuze, with biomaterial manufacturing to create what it says is a sustainable, customisable leather alternative that mimics the texture and performance of traditional leather. The company believes that carbohydrate-based designs can lack the molecular structure required to behave like skin. Instead, the Elevate product uses grain proteins fused with other plant-based elements to replicate the scaffolding functions of collagen, which is the primary protein in animal hides.

“Automotive interiors require the highest-possible durability and quality,” added Stephanie Downs, CEO and co-founder of Uncaged Innovations. “Developing a scalable, sustainable alternative for vehicle interiors underpins the strength of the technology behind our entire platform, helping us create luxurious and durable materials for a wide range of applications and industries.”
